FRACTIONAL MACLAURIN-TYPE INEQUALITIES FOR TWICE-DIFFERENTIABLE FUNCTIONS
Fatih Hezenci
Abstract
We prove an equality for twice-differentiable functions whose second derivatives in absolute value are convex. We use this, together with the Hölder and power-mean inequalities, to establish some Maclaurin-type inequalities for Riemann–Liouville fractional integrals. We conclude with some special cases.
